Ascend Learning has an employee rating of 3.9 out of 5 stars, based on 511 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Ascend Learning employ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Education industry (3.7 stars).

Pros

Very organized.Structured. Low expectations.

Cons

The interview consists of meeting assignments over the course of 6 days to demonstrate you can navigate the system and be available as desired. No room for academic freedom. Mostly canned responses to students. Must work every Saturday morning, non-negotiable, 22-24 hours per week. Pays $75 per student, assigned one class of students at a time, students have 12 weeks to complete program.If you get the students to "green light" quickly it pays okay. If the students are unmotivated, the average salary works out to be $7-16/hour. For a job requiring an MSN prepared educator, this is poor.
